Hypercore Protocol
Development
Hypercore Protocol is a secure, distributed append-only log built on top of Hypercore, which is a secure peer-to-peer datastore. It allows for decentralized apps and filesystems to be built using append-only logs as their storage mechanism.

Mailinblack
Security & Privacy
Mailinblack is an email protection software designed to block spam, phishing attempts, malware, ransomware and targeted attacks in incoming emails. It uses AI and machine learning to analyze emails and attachments to detect threats.
